Output 24c56f370af63cca57a44e23ace9eb64fd1b3bdda6dd7dfff8d380d407985662:1

value
451956964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e9ce5d309aa1b143d4213c1f486b327e7f8f115 OP_EQUAL
address
MAh2TdcFZ4BYVSwkbVEfxbekgMmpLDMk1C
transaction
24c56f370af63cca57a44e23ace9eb64fd1b3bdda6dd7dfff8d380d407985662
spent
true